10-Acre Site Sold in Missouri City for Hotel and Warehouse Development

Source: Colliers International

MISSOURI CITY, Texas — Colliers International has completed the sale of 10 acres along Beltway 8 in Missouri City, intended for the development of a hotel and several office-warehouse buildings. The property sits near the intersection of Sam Houston Parkway and McClain Boulevard, a strategic location for both hospitality and industrial uses.

MAA Hospitality purchased a 1.4-acre parcel to develop a Crystal Inn hotel. Graniti Vicentia Realty LLC acquired the remaining 8.3 acres for industrial development, signaling continued demand for distribution and light industrial space in the area.

Tom Condon Jr. of Colliers International represented the seller, Al-Attas Babidan Basmaih Joint Venture. Claude Angelo of Belt International Realty Company represented both buyers, facilitating the transactions. David Pitschmann with Alamo Title Company coordinated the closing process.

The site is located just north of U.S. 90A and borders Gateway Southwest Industrial Park in Harris County, giving the development convenient access to regional transportation routes and existing industrial infrastructure. The combination of hotel and industrial uses is positioned to serve visitors and businesses drawn to the growing commercial corridor along Beltway 8.
